Transaction 03056603aac5ed6c96743ed2b9e1904d5c2b040acfeeca72a1bb09731f1aa902
1 Input
1 Output
-
03056603aac5ed6c96743ed2b9e1904d5c2b040acfeeca72a1bb09731f1aa902:0
- value
- 2893
- script pubkey
- OP_0 OP_PUSHBYTES_20 32da73bbdd23c0b467ba6589ff02165439f757aa
- address
- bc1qxtd88w7ay0qtgea6vkyl7qsk2sulw4a223zd2v